'Ensemble Art'

Our concept was called ‘Ensemble Art’--a name inspired by the community’s final product. The premise was simple: people in Central Paris could contribute towards generative art constructions while within the mapped region.

We divided Central Paris into three regions.(Main EthCC events centered right around the Paris legend)

A Collaborative Experience

After navigating to ensemble.mentaport.xyz on their phone, each contributor would consult the map (see above), and view their regional artwork’s real-time construction status in augmented reality. The contributor could add to the communal work through building a block of their preferred shape and color. While we virtually underlaid the landmarks’ foundations, the final composition and identity emerged from a collaborative effort.

Before any contributions, specifically each regional Token #1, the canvas was blank.

The first contribution, or token #1, in the middle region of the map.

Participants could then contribute one block. There were three themes which correlated with each distinct landmark:

  • North: “Colonne de Juilette” which was composed of wings. 
  • Middle: “Tour de Eiffel” which was composed of flowers.
  • South: “Catacombes de Paris” composed of skulls.

While we framed the landmark, the community determined the composition’s color and shape .You can view the pieces at OpenSea . The final results are displayed below:

The final NFTs. Each individual token is bound to a 3D model.
The final constructions: “Colonne de Juilette”, “Tour de Eiffel” and “Catacombes de Paris” left to right (participant pieces are colors other than gold).

Unsurprisingly, the most significant contributions happened in the middle region, “Colonne de Juilette”, near the EthCC conference’s main location. The northern region, where the ETH hackathon took place, fell into second place. And somehow, only a few folks braved exploring the Panthéon and Catacombes.
